Spencer Silver, who helped invent the Post-it Note, dies at age 80
by Associated Press from on (#5HSX2)
The corporate scientist discovered the unique adhesive that allowed notes to be easily attached to surfaces and removed
The inventor of the adhesive used on the Post-it Note has died, according to the company 3M, which produces the product, and his published obituary.
Spencer Silver was 80 and died May 8 at his home, the family's obituary said.
